Host Erin Sparks and Guest Joe Martinez discuss this weeks trending topics:


Google Changes the Meta Robots Nofollow Tag from a Directive to a Hint

The Nofollow page tag was previously a directive to stop a web crawler from following links, but now it’s just a hint, which means a Google crawler may or may not obey the Nofollow tag. 

Google Launches Two New Link Attribution Tags

rel=“sponsored” is for links created as part of advertising, sponsorships, etc. and rel=“ugc” is for links in user generated content. Both will be treated as hints for links to exclude as ranking signals. 

Google Says Ranking Factors Don’t Include Content Accuracy

Google thinks machine learning isn’t quite good enough yet at assessing content accuracy to make it a ranking factor, which is why it relies instead on various signals for topic relevance and authority.
